Does aluminum foil reflect infrared?

Yes, aluminum foil does reflect infrared. Infrared radiation is a type of electromagnetic radiation with a longer wavelength than visible light. When infrared radiation is incident upon a surface, it produces a thermal effect known as infrared absorption.

Aluminum is reflective of infrared radiation because its surface has a low absorption coefficient. This means that instead of absorbing the radiation, the aluminum foil reflects the radiation back out.

As a result, aluminum foil is a popular material for insulation. It can be used to line walls, floors, and ceilings in order to prevent thermal energy from escaping. Additionally, aluminum foil can be used to create reflective shields around objects or materials that require insulation from infrared radiation, such as electronic equipment and machinery.

Can infrared reflect off a surface?

Yes, infrared light can reflect off a surface, just as visible light can. This can happen when radiation that is emitted into the air is incident on a surface, causing part or all of the light to bounce off.

When infrared radiation reflects off of a surface, it will change the direction in which it is traveling and can be detected by a sensor that is tuned to pick up the frequencies of infrared radiation.

This process is known as specular reflection, and it happens when the angle of the incident radiation is equal to the angle of reflection. The amount of infrared radiation reflected will depend on the type of surface, its reflectivity, and the angle at which the radiation is incident.

In some cases, infrared radiation may be totally reflected off surfaces, meaning that none of it enters the surface, or it may be partially reflected which means that some of the radiation will enter the surface and some will be reflected back.

How do you block infrared rays?

The simplest and most cost effective way is to use window film, which is designed to minimize the penetration of infrared light through windows. Window films typically have a coating that reflects infrared light and reduces the amount of heat and light entering a space.

Additionally, blackout curtains can help to absorb excess infrared radiation. These curtains have a metallic back coating that reflects the infrared rays and helps to keep any space cooler. Other materials such as insulation, aluminum foil, and reflective paint can also be used to block out infrared radiation.

Finally, if an area needs significant protection from infrared radiation, specialized insulation can be used with multiple layers of reflective material to reduce the passage of both heat and light into a space.
